How much do part time ic layout eng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 17, 2026, the average yearly pay for part time ic layout engineer in the United States is $120,849.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$90,000.00 and $144,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Part Time Ic Layout Engineer vs Part Time ASIC Design Engineer?

AspectPart Time Ic Layout EngineerPart Time ASIC Design Engineer
Primary FocusPhysical layout and placement of integrated circuitsDesign and verification of ASIC architecture and logic
Skills & CertificationsIC layout tools, CAD software, knowledge of fabrication processesHardware description languages, digital design, verification tools
Work EnvironmentDesign houses, semiconductor companies, R&D labsDesign firms, semiconductor companies, R&D labs
Industry UsageCommonly used in semiconductor manufacturing and physical design teamsUsed in digital design teams for ASIC development

While both roles involve working within the semiconductor industry, the Part Time Ic Layout Engineer focuses on the physical implementation of integrated circuits, whereas the Part Time ASIC Design Engineer concentrates on the logical design and architecture of ASICs. Both roles require specialized skills and are integral to chip development, but they differ in their core responsibilities and tools used.

You will be the Integrated Circuit Layout Designer for the Readout Integrated Circuit (ROIC) design team at Lockheed Martin's Santa Barbara Focal plane business. Our team delivers world class ROICs that power next generation infrared and visible spectrum imagers for defense, science, and commercial markets.
What You Will Be Doing
As the Integrated Circuit Layout Designer you will translate high performance analog and digital schematics into robust silicon layouts that meet sub micron, mixed signal VLSI specifications. Working side by side with circuit designers, verification engineers, and process experts, you will turn cutting edge ROIC concepts into manufacturable silicon blocks that enable ultra low noise, low power, high speed imaging. Your responsibilities will include:
• Perform full custom physical layout of mixed signal CMOS transistor level designs, including ultra low noise front ends, low power ADCs, and multi GHz SERDES blocks.
• Apply Design for Manufacturability (DFM) and Design for Test (DFT) techniques to satisfy tight area, thermal, and performance constraints.
• Generate and maintain layout documentation, DRC/LVS reports, and tape out release packages.
• Conduct parasitic extraction and post layout simulations to verify electrical performance against specifications.
• Collaborate with circuit designers, verification engineers, and process engineers to resolve layout issues quickly and iterate efficiently.
• Implement and enforce best practice guidelines in the team's layout library.
• Mentor junior technicians, fostering an inclusive, knowledge sharing culture.

Basic Qualifications:
Bachelor's or higher level degree in related discipline with 3+ years of experience in IC layout design
OR
Training and 5+ years of experience in IC layout design
Experience with IC design in Cadence Virtuoso tool suite
Desired Skills:
Experience in custom CMOS integrated circuit transistor and standard cell layout
Experience in Cadence Virtuoso Layout XL, GXL, MXL, and Siemens Calibre
